Two cars used in testing tractors during International Agricultural-Tractor Trials, carried out near Wallingford; larger consists of chassis on three wheels, front wheel being employed only for steering, while rear wheels are coupled up through gear box to electric generator; pull on car is measured by means of traction dynamometer, which consists of two parts, link through which tractor pulls car, and recording unit mounted on car.
Dynamometer car for tractor trials
